def getStatsOld(fileName): f=file(fileName,"r") data=[] for line in f: line=line.replace('(','') line=line.replace(')','') (rate,loc,N,cert,tests,guess,right,lname,lastCountT,lastCountD,seed)=line.split(',') data.append([float(rate),int(loc),int(N),float(cert),float(tests),int(guess),right.strip()=='True',lname.strip(),int(lastCountT),int(lastCountD),int(seed)]) f.close() return collStats.collStats(data,names)
def getStats(matchList): data=[] for (k,v) in statDb.iteritems(): (rate,loc,N,cert,lastCountT,lastCountD,lname,seed)=k (tests,guess,right)=v if ((lastCountT,lastCountD),rate) in matchList[1]: if N in matchList[0]: if cert in matchList[2]: if lname in matchList[4]: data.append([rate,loc,N,cert,tests,guess,right,lname,lastCountT,lastCountD,seed]) return collStats.collStats(data,names)
def getStats(matchList): data = [] for (k, v) in statDb.iteritems(): (rate, loc, N, cert, lastCountT, lastCountD, lname, seed) = k (tests, guess, right) = v if ((lastCountT, lastCountD), rate) in matchList[1]: if N in matchList[0]: if cert in matchList[2]: if lname in matchList[4]: data.append([ rate, loc, N, cert, tests, guess, right, lname, lastCountT, lastCountD, seed ]) return collStats.collStats(data, names)
def getStatsOld(fileName): f = file(fileName, "r") data = [] for line in f: line = line.replace('(', '') line = line.replace(')', '') (rate, loc, N, cert, tests, guess, right, lname, lastCountT, lastCountD, seed) = line.split(',') data.append([ float(rate), int(loc), int(N), float(cert), float(tests), int(guess), right.strip() == 'True', lname.strip(), int(lastCountT), int(lastCountD), int(seed) ]) f.close() return collStats.collStats(data, names)